Description
Technical field
The utility model relates to textile technology field, is specially a kind of weaving go-cart.
Background technology
Total institute is known, after having weaved, all by the packing of cloth rolling, cloth is normally crimped onto by winding roller and winding roller is formed by the formation of every roll cloth under the drive of actuating device, after being wound to a certain amount of cloth, just need the winding roller removing rolling, the winding roller more renewed, but, when removing the winding roller of rolling, normally rely on a dead lift, this kind of mode is time-consuming, take manpower, the needs that science is produced cannot be met, in actual use, although the carrying of winding roller can be completed by go-cart, but existing go-cart transportation volume is less in this handling process, thus need user's many times transports, therefore work efficiency has been had a strong impact on, and, traditional go-cart level of mechanization is not high, waste a large amount of manpowers.

Compared with prior art, the beneficial effects of the utility model are: this weaving cart structure is simple, by offering chute at base, and organize bracket by slide block connection more, the transportation volume of this go-cart is promoted greatly, and by the telescopic action of expansion link, utilize driven by motor pulley rotation, thus driving mechanical grabs the movement to winding roller, save a large amount of manpower and materials, realize mechanization completely, improve work efficiency greatly.
